Hi Mingying:
I tried the target: "agl-cluster-demo-qtcompositor" on agl 9.0.1 with rpi4 platform but the gauges does not show up. The afm-util shows the widget has installed well.
raspberrypi4:~# afm-util list
[
{ "description":"Cluster gauges demo application", "name":"cluster-gauges", "shortname":"", "id":"cluster-gauges@1.0-ff6f0c2", "version":"1.0-ff6f0c2", "author":"Ouyang Jun <ouyangj.fnst@cn.fujitsu.com>", "author-email":"", "width":"", "height":"", "icon":"/var/local/lib/afm/applications/cluster-gauges/1.0-ff6f0c2/icon.png" }
]
When I tried to start the widget manually, it shows cannot-start.
raspberrypi4:~# afm-util start cluster-gauges@1.0-ff6f0c2
[ 55.186456] audit: type=1400 audit(1596850183.087:7): lsm=SMACK fn=smack_inode_permission action=denied subject="User::App::cluster-gauges" object="_" requested=wx pid=464 comm="mkdir" name="app-data" dev="mmcblk0p2" ino=4317
[ 55.209363] audit: type=1300 audit(1596850183.087:7): arch=c00000b7 syscall=34 success=no exit=-13 a0=ffffffffffffff9c a1=7fc387dcf5 a2=1ff a3=0 items=0 ppid=1 pid=464 auid=4294967295 uid=0 gid=0 euid=0 suid=0 fsuid=0 egid=0 sgid=0 fsgid=0 tty=(none) ses=4294967295 comm="mkdir" exe="/bin/mkdir.coreutils" subj=User::App::cluster-gauges key=(null)
[ 55.241404] audit: type=1327 audit(1596850183.087:7): proctitle=2F62696E2F6D6B646972002D70002F686F6D652F302F6170702D646174612F636C75737465722D676175676573
ERROR: cannot-start
Since rpi4 should be a official platform, I guess this might be a common issue and report here.
